Answer:

1/2

Step-by-step explanation:

According to pythagoras theorem;

(sinx)²+(cosx)² = 1

Given that sinФ = √3/2

Substitute into the formula

(√3/2)²+(cosx)² = 1

3/4+(cosx)² = 1

(cosx)² = 1 - 3/4

(cosx)²  = 1/4

cos x = √1/4

cos x = 1/2

Hence the value of cosФ is 1/2
